NSFW 是什么

NSFW 是一个英文网络用语,是 Not Safe For Work 或者 Not Suitable For Work 的缩写,意思是某个网络内容不适合上班时间浏览。

它通常被用于标记那些带有淫秽色情、暴力血腥、极端另类等内容的邮件、视频、博客、论坛帖子里等,以免读者不恰当的点击浏览。常见的用法是,在链接的后面,加上一对括号,括号中标记 NSFW。

转自杜老师说https://dusays.com

API介绍

NYP全称为No Yellow Picture,简单来说,这就是一个图片鉴黄打分api。

注意!此api完全免费!

运行原理

此api是的基础就是NSFW这个JavaScript库(开源地址:https://github.com/infinitered/nsfwjs),这个库是通过机器ai学习出来的,依旧在不断完善。

这个库经杜老师打包,并通过docker容器安装到我的服务器中,而且经过我的nginx服务器反向代理,可以直接通过域名访问。

通过提供图片地址,这个api会调用上述的JavaScript库,对提交的图片进行分析,最终会给出一个0~100的值。

这个值越偏向0,说明这张图片偏向成人化,相反则同理,若这个值越偏向100,说明这张图片越偏向正经化::microsoft:grinning_squinting_face_3d::。

运行模式

调用地址

不说了,上调用地址!

https://yeapi.linkkk.top

调用方法

来到图片审核页面,将上述地址填入接口地址中。(如下图所示)审核驱动选择NsfwJs,属性名称为image,阈值可酌情调整,建议为60左右。

兰空图床演示

在此,给大家推荐一款免费公益图床,深海图床(https://img.arcitcgn.cn),由arcitcgn同学提供高速图片外链服务,感兴趣的可以去试试!
  • 同时,我也提供了一个手动调用方法。参照如下示例执行命令,即可获得返回数值!
curl -X POST -F "image=@FILENAME.jpg" http://yeapi.linkkk.top/classify
最后修改:2024 年 01 月 24 日
如果觉得我的文章对你有用,请随意赞赏